titleOfInvention | NEW ORGANIC OXYGEN ESTERS WITH ALCOHOLS DERIVED FROM 19-NOR STEROIDS, THEIR SALTS, THE PROCEDURE AND THE INTERMEDIATES FOR THEIR PREPARATION AND THE INGREDIENTS CONTAINING THEM |
abstract | The invention relates to novel organic acid esters ofnalcohols derived from 19-steroids, with generalnformula:nSl 9011513nAn(I) wherein R is an aliphatic hydrocarbon radical; Ffe innR3 are the same or different and represent hydrogen or alkyl;nG is a hydrocarbon group of 1-18 carbon atoms,ncontaining, where appropriate, one or more equals ornof different hetero-atoms bonded to the steroid nucleusnover carbon; and X represents Xa, wherenXa is hydrogen, alkyl, aralkyl or acyl and in this case Ynrepresents the group Ya with the meaning -B-O-CO-A-Z, wherenB is divalent, saturated or unsaturated aliphaticnstraight or branched radical, A is divalent,na saturated or unsaturated aliphatic radical with a straight ornbranched species, if necessary interrupted or terminated byndivalent aromatic radical or representsna divalent aromatic radical and Z is a -COOH groupnor SO3H, which is converted to a salt as needed; or Xnrepresents Xb, with the meaning -CO-A-Z, where A and Z,nas defined above and in this case Y representsna group Yb selected from the group consisting of -Cntriple bond C-R4, -CH = CH-R4 or -CK2-CH2.-R4, wherenR4 is hydrogen, halogen, trialkylsilyl, alkyl or phenyl, wherein:nalkyl and phenyl groups optionally substituted. |
